When connecting to Google analytics to Power Bi, there is to data for me to load

Hi, im new to Power Bi, so i dont know if I've done anything wrong with the setup. When I connected my Power Bi to google analytics Data source and was prompted to sign in. I got everything connected but the folder was empty.

Hi @Anonymous 

You need to keep clicking on the little black triangles next to each item name. This will open up the tree and you will see more options.

Burningsuit_0-1633426126544.png

 

The Google Analytics data in particular is buried quite far down multiple trees.
